The most common causes for AC fan blower motor not working in BMW X5 are blown fuse, bad relay, resistor or control module malfunction and faulty blower motor. However, a bad electrical connector or broken wire, or a defect in the climate control unit can also cause the blower motor to stop working. 1. Blown fuse. If your A/C blows warm air while sitting in traffic is the sign of failed aux fan because if the A/C condenser gets too hot it will shut down the compressor by design. Aux fan is also vital to your engine cooling too, your car can get over heat while sitting in traffic. 02- 530-Blown. 10-X5 35D.
